KCK Alcohol Safety Action Project

KCK Alcohol Safety Action Project is an addiction treatment facility at 831 Armstrong Avenue in Kansas City, Kansas, offering outpatient treatment and medication-assisted treatment, according to its SAMHSA FindTreatment.gov listing as of April 10, 2026. Payment options listed in the record include Cash or self-payment and Sliding fee scale (fee is based on income and other factors). The directory lists 913-342-3011 as the facility's phone number. All details on this page come from that federal record and should be confirmed directly with the facility.
